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ions: Cisco Small Business RV110W, RV130, RV130W, and RV215W Routers (affected versions not specified)
Description: The issue is related to improper validation of user-supplied input in the web-based management interface of the affected routers. An authenticated, remote attacker could exploit this by sending crafted HTTP requests to execute arbitrary code as the root user on the underlying operating system or cause the device to reload, resulting in a denial of service (DoS) condition. The attacker would need valid administrator credentials on the affected device to exploit the issue.
Recommendations: At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
